    Q: What is the best way to book a hotel in Bangkok?

    A: We recommend booking your hotel in advance to ensure availability and to get the best prices. You can use online booking platforms such as Booking.com, Agoda, or Hotels.com to compare prices and find the best deals.

    Q: What are the most popular neighborhoods in Bangkok for tourists?

    A: Some of the most popular neighborhoods in Bangkok for tourists are Sukhumvit, Silom, Sathorn, and Khao San Road. These areas offer a range of accommodations, shopping, dining, and entertainment options.
